Gualou is the dried mature fruit of Trichosanthes kirilowii Maxim., commonly known as snakegourd or Chinese cucumber. It is a traditional Chinese medicinal herb primarily used to clear heat and resolve phlegm in the lungs. Gualou is indicated for conditions such as cough with thick, sticky phlegm, chest congestion, lung abscesses, breast abscesses (mastitis), and constipation due to heat and dryness in the intestines[2][5]. Its main pharmacological actions include anti-inflammatory effects (suppressing targets like IL-6, IL-1β, TNF-α), antioxidant activity[1][5], regulation of vascular endothelial growth/function (affecting VEGFA and eNOS), improvement of blood lipid levels[1], diuretic properties (promoting urination)[5], and moistening/lubricating the intestines[4][5]. The active compounds include trichosanthin among others. Modern research has explored its potential for managing diabetes and tumors; laboratory studies suggest antiviral activity against HIV replication via trichosanthin protein but clinical evidence remains limited[3]. Gualou should be used with caution during pregnancy due to abortifacient effects reported for root extracts.
